Union Home Minister Amit Shah, at a rally in Guwahati on March 15, claimed there had been no major extremist or militant attacks in Assam in the past five years. It is hard to define what a ‘major’ attack is. But the data from the Ministry of Home Affairs (MHA) suggests this claim is inaccurate.

According to  the 2019-20 annual report published by the MHA, Assam witnessed 153 insurgency-related incidents between 2016 and 2019.
